Orange was launched in 1994, promising to make mobile phones affordable for anyone. It was a bold proposition at the time when mobile phones were considered to be flashy devices by bankers. The name, which was an ode to words that refer to fruit, was atypical for the industry. The brand was designed by an in-house design team led by Hans Snook, Chris Moss and Chris Moss. The brand had a distinct brand identity and slogan - "The Future's Bright; the Future's Orange."

Hutchison Whampoa acquired Microtel Communications Ltd in the year 1990. Orange Personal Communications Services Ltd was launched in the year following. The company was a public limited company until 2000 when it was acquired by France Telecom for PS2bn.

The Orange brand remained used internationally and was popular in France, Germany and Italy. In 2010, the UK business was merged with T-Mobile owned by Deutsche Telekom to create EE. Jamster

It's difficult to pick up any phone in the UK without seeing an advertisement for Jamster, but Jamster has been slapped with a scathing rebuke from the Advertising Standards Authority (ASA). The company aired ads featuring its ringtone and mobile wallpaper characters Crazy Frog and Sweetie the Chick However, a lot of people complained that the commercials were false.

The complaint alleges the ads deceived consumers by suggesting that they would get free ringtones when they send an email to the short number shown in the ad. In reality, the company charged regular premium short message charges on consumers who pay their monthly cellphone bills. The company charged for multiple messages, even though consumers hadn't downloaded one ringtone.

The terms and conditions were not clearly stated. Those who received the bill were not informed of the fact that the service was subscription-based. The advertising company's practices was in violation of ASA guidelines, and it has been ordered to stop using the characters in any future TV commercials.
